E-Bike Laws & Regulations in New York
Understanding local e-bike regulations is essential before riding in New York. Here is a summary of the current rules.
| Classes Allowed | Class 1, Class 2, Class 3 |
| Speed Limits | 25 mph for Class 3; 20 mph for Class 1 and 2 |
| Where Allowed | Streets, bike lanes, and most multi-use paths. Class 3 restricted from some greenways. |
| Helmet Requirement | Required for Class 3 riders; recommended for all |
Note: NYC legalized all three e-bike classes in 2020. Throttle-assist Class 2 bikes are permitted on streets and bike lanes.

Top E-Bike Trails & Routes in New York
New York offers great riding options for e-cyclists. Here are the top trails and routes to explore.
Hudson River Greenway
A 12.9-mile paved path along Manhattan's west side with stunning river and skyline views.
Brooklyn Bridge to Prospect Park Loop
A scenic 8-mile route crossing the iconic bridge and looping through Brooklyn's premier park.
Central Park Loop
The classic 6.1-mile loop with rolling hills, car-free roads, and iconic NYC landmarks.
Terrain & Climate in New York
Terrain
New York is mostly flat with minimal elevation changes. The average commute is 10 miles.
Flat terrain means you will get maximum range from your e-bike battery. Both hub-drive and mid-drive motors work well here. Use our range calculator to estimate your expected range.
Climate & Battery Tips
Cold winters with snow and hot humid summers. Battery range drops 15-20% in winter. Fenders and lights are essential year-round.
